Ethiopia vs Turkey
Every indicator for Ethiopia and Turkey side by side, with the percentage gap between them. Sources are listed at the bottom of the page.
| Indicator | Ethiopia | Turkey |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population (2025) (people) | 135,472,051 | 85,878,556 | +57.7% |
| GDP (nominal) (billion $) | 126 | 1,597 | −92.1% |
| GDP per capita ($) | 933 | 18,599 | −95.0% |
| Life expectancy (years) | 67.6 | 77.4 | — |
| Area (km²) | 1,136,240 | 785,350 | +44.7% |
| Population density (people/km²) | 119 | 109 | +9.0% |
| Median age (years) | 19.0 | 34.4 | — |
| Internet usage (%) | 21.9 | 89.8 | — |
| Unemployment rate (%) | 3.3 | 8.5 | — |
| Inflation (%) | 13.2 | 34.9 | — |
| Urban population (%) | 24.1 | 89.5 | — |
| Military expenditure (2024) (million $) | 922 | 24,979 | −96.3% |
| Military expenditure as a share of GDP (%) | 0.65 | 1.92 | −66.1% |
| Military expenditure as a share of government spending (%) | 6.91 | — | — |
| Military expenditure per capita ($) | 7 | 291 | −97.7% |
| Armed forces personnel (2020) (people) | 138,000 | 512,000 | −73.0% |
| Armed forces per 1,000 people (people) | 1.0 | 6.0 | −82.9% |
| Armed forces as a share of the labor force (%) | 0.28 | 1.61 | −82.6% |
The difference column shows the percentage gap of Ethiopia relative to Turkey; a positive value favors Ethiopia. Interpret it in context — for unemployment, a lower value is better.
